diff options
Diffstat (limited to 'lrparser/org.eclipse.cdt.core.lrparser/old/org/eclipse/cdt/internal/core/dom/lrparser/c99/bindings/C99Enumeration.java')
-rw-r--r-- | lrparser/org.eclipse.cdt.core.lrparser/old/org/eclipse/cdt/internal/core/dom/lrparser/c99/bindings/C99Enumeration.java |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/lrparser/org.eclipse.cdt.core.lrparser/old/org/eclipse/cdt/internal/core/dom/lrparser/c99/bindings/C99Enumeration.java b/lrparser/org.eclipse.cdt.core.lrparser/old/org/eclipse/cdt/internal/core/dom/lrparser/c99/bindings/C99Enumeration.java index e0b0f1b03ee..f8964535df2 100644 --- a/lrparser/org.eclipse.cdt.core.lrparser/old/org/eclipse/cdt/internal/core/dom/lrparser/c99/bindings/C99Enumeration.java +++ b/lrparser/org.eclipse.cdt.core.lrparser/old/org/eclipse/cdt/internal/core/dom/lrparser/c99/bindings/C99Enumeration.java @@ -32,7 +32,7 @@ import org.eclipse.core.runtime.PlatformObject; @SuppressWarnings("restriction") public class C99Enumeration extends PlatformObject implements IC99Binding, IEnumeration, ITypeable { - private List<IEnumerator> enumerators = new ArrayList<IEnumerator>(); + private List<IEnumerator> enumerators = new ArrayList<>(); private String name; private IScope scope; @@ -86,7 +86,7 @@ public class C99Enumeration extends PlatformObject implements IC99Binding, IEnum public C99Enumeration clone() { try { C99Enumeration clone = (C99Enumeration) super.clone(); - clone.enumerators = new ArrayList<IEnumerator>(); + clone.enumerators = new ArrayList<>(); for (IEnumerator e : enumerators) { // TODO this is wrong, // IEnumerator is not Cloneable so we are not returning a deep copy here |